Millwall defender Japhet Tanganga could be on the move during the summer transfer window.


OneFootball Videos


The former Tottenham Hotspur man has rediscovered himself in the second tier during the last 18 months at The Den, originally joining on loan before completing a free transfer last summer.

Solidifying the Lions' backline with his leadership, physicality and natural ability to read the game ahead of others, Tanganga has showcased why he is destined for a return to one of the big European leagues, with a number of clubs interested in making a move for him on a cut-price deal.

Japhet Tanganga to prefer a move to Germany or France this summer

According to journalist Alan Nixon, Japhet Tanganga would prefer his next move to be overseas.

It is believed the defender is keen on a move to a club in Germany or France in the coming weeks or months, delivering a body blow to the various Premier League clubs interested in securing his services.

Tanganga had a previous move to a German outfit, making the switch to Bundesliga team Augsburg during the first half of the 2023/24 campaign, but he failed to make a single appearance because of a reoccurring knee injury.

It appears Tanganga may be feeling like he has unfinished business in the German top-flight after failing to get a taste of Bundesliga action, and is hoping his impressive performances at Millwall are enough to make his dreams a reality.

Crystal Palace enter the race for Japhet Tanganga’s signature

As per the Daily Express, Crystal Palace have joined the race to sign Japhet Tanganga.

A sale to Selhurst Park is all dependent on whether Marc Guehi leaves the London outfit, but it could be a possibility as the England international has once again been linked with a move to Newcastle United.

The report also states that because the Eagles are a more stable Premier League club and have the prospect of European football, they would have the edge in the pursuit, with Tanganga wanting his future sorted by the end of the month.

Burnley particularly keen on Japhet Tanganga as Leeds United, Sunderland competition emerges

As per a report by GiveMeSport, promoted trio Leeds United, Burnley and Sunderland are also weighing up a move for Japhet Tanganga, as they prepare to bolster their squads ahead of their Premier League returns.

Burnley are reported to be particularly keen on luring the defender away from The Den, with the report revealing Tanganga has a release clause of under £2 million, making him a very affordable option.

Scott Parker is a long-term admirer of the 26-year-old’s ability to play in both a back three and a back four, with the Clarets viewing the defender as a perfect fit for their rebuild.
